Milner Ready For AORC Season Opener With The KTM DM31 Off-Road Racing Team

Published On: March 5th, 2024Categories: News

Daniel Milner is set to take on the 2024 Australian Off-Road Championship (AORC) at the season opener this weekend in Roma, Qld, for Rounds 1 & 2. 

The Multi-time AORC, A4DE, ISDE and Hattah Desert Race Champion will now be competing under the formation of his own racing program for 2024, with the KTM DM31 Off-Road Racing Team.

Ready to chase the AORC Championship #1 Plate that he vacated at the end of 2021, Milner has learned a lot from his time in the Enduro GP Championship in Europe over the last two seasons and is excited to apply this knowledge to racing domestically here in Australia.

“My time in Europe was great and I learned a tremendous amount as a rider and as a human being, living for two years in Italy with my wife and children” commented Milner.

“There’s no place like home and I’m excited to be back racing at the AORC this weekend. I’ve been back training with the Beatons Pro Formula coaching program for a few months now, I can feel my speed, intensity and sharpness coming back training with the ProMX riders and it has been refreshing to get back into a familiar program after my time in Europe”, said Milner.

“Obviously the big change for this year is that I have partnered with the KTM Group to run my own Team program. At this stage in my career it’s an exciting change for me and we have been able to resume some of my long standing partnerships with brands in Australia along with forging new ones to help us go racing in 2024 and beyond”, Milner concluded.

As the KTM Australia representative in the E2 class aboard the KTM 450 EXC-F , Milner will be joined by his new team mate for 2024, as New Zealand’s Tom Buxton will compete in the E1 class riding on the KTM 250 EXC-F.

The KTM DM31 Off-Road Racing Team will debut at Rounds 1 & 2 of the AORC Championship at Roma, QLD March 9th and 10th.
